8ae5c4ea697b2186ca0c367bff21c4420312e2ac476ca68232f3474a65e1b6a6

1115645 (601196 blocks ago)

⏴ Block 1115644 (0864f028...e59) | Block 1115646 ⏵ | Latest block ⏭

Metadata

2/8/22, 4:12 am UTC (834d 23:52:55 ago) 19.1 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details